    Abstract: An adjustable roof jack adapted for mounting on a flat or pitched roof. The roof jack is connected to a lower end of an air discharge duct from an air conditioning unit and to the top of an air supply duct in the roof. The roof jack includes an angular-shaped sheet metal lower frame member having a front side, back side, a first side and second side. A lower portion of the sides of the lower frame member is received around the top of the air supply duct. Also, the lower portion of the sides of the lower frame member is integrally formed into to an outwardly extending roof flange. The roof jack also includes an angular-shaped sheet metal upper frame member having a front side, a back side, a first side and second side. A top portion of the front side of the upper frame member is hinged to a bottom portion of the front side of the upper frame member.

    Abstract: A method for controlling Pitch and Stickies is disclosed. The method comprises adding hydrophobically modified hydroxyethyl cellulose (HMHEC) and cationic polymers to a cellulosic fiber slurry (pulp) or to a paper process or to a paper making system and results in a higher degree of inhibiting organic deposition and retention of pitch on paper fiber as compared to the inhibition of the individual ingredients. The combination of HMHEC and cationic polymers surprising results in a synergistic effect.

    Abstract: A process for treating a composition containing a polyamine-epihalohydrin resin that has a low level of CPD-producing species and good gelation stability is disclosed. A polyamine-epihalohydrin resin is prepared with a ratio of epihalohydrin:amine of less than about 1.1:1.0; The resin is then subjected to a base treatment followed by an acid treatment resulting in a resin that has good gelation storage stability and produces low levels of CPD.

    Abstract: Synergistic mixtures of biocides and their use to control the growth of microorganisms in aqueous systems are disclosed. The method of using the synergistic mixtures entails adding an effective amount of a nitrogenous compound activated by an oxidant and at least one non-oxidizing biocide to an aqueous system. The amount of activated nitrogenous compound and non-oxidizing biocide is selected to result in a synergistic biocidal effect.

    Abstract: The present invention relates to a process for making polyalkyldiallylamine-epihalohydrin resins, the resultant resins and their uses as wet strength additives for papermaking. These resins are obtained by a two step process, wherein the first step comprises the free radical polymerization or copolymerization of an alkyldiallylamine monomer in its protonated form; and the second step comprises reacting an ADAA polymer or copolymer with epihalohydrin under carefully controlled reaction conditions.

    Abstract: A check valve is placed in a conduit for pressurized fluids, and comprises a cylindrical external housing having inlet and outlet ends, a cylindrical internal spigot, and an elastomeric sleeve fitted over the spigot. It is sealed at the second end, and has a plurality of radially directed vent apertures along its length. The elastomeric sleeve is securely fitted to the internal spigot, in the region of the first, inlet end. The elastomeric sleeve has an internal diameter and an elastic memory such that it fits and adheres snugly to the outer periphery of the spigot, and its elasticity is overcome at a positive gauge pressure of between 5 and 20 psi so that pressurized fluid will flow from the vent apertures. Backflow of fluid at substantially zero or negative gauge pressure is precluded.

    Abstract: This invention provides a light white mineral oil-based fluidized polymer suspension (FPS) composition for use as a rheology modifier in paper coatings. It has been found that by using a selected composition of low viscosity oil as a carrier, high solids content and environmental friendly fluidized polymer suspensions of water soluble cellulose derivatives, synthetic water soluble polymers, guar gum and derivatives, starch and derivatives and mixtures thereof, can be prepared. The FPS of the present invention was found to provide unexpected beneficial performance properties when added as a rheology modifier to a paper coating containing standard binders, pigment, and water. The oil-based fluid polymer suspension composition of the present invention for use as a rheology modifier in the paper coating comprises: a hydrophilic polymer, b) an organophilic clay, c) a surfactant stabilizer, and d) a light white mineral oil having selected properties.

    Abstract: A vehicle washing apparatus having a frame suspended from the ceiling and adapted for encircling a vehicle, the frame being capable of being raised and lowered with respect to the vehicle and provided with nozzles for ejecting fluid against the vehicle to clean the vehicle. A pair of overhead bars extend transversely of the vehicle and are supported for traveling longitudinally with respect to the vehicle, the overhead bars being provided with nozzles for ejecting fluid onto the top of the vehicle. The overhead bars are movable towards and away from one another to wash the entire top of the vehicle.

    Abstract: Methods for making creping adhesives and using them in the creping of cellulosic fiber webs. The creping adhesives are a combination of polyamine-epihalohydrin and poly(vinyl alcohol). The method comprises the preparation and application of the creping adhesives to attain strong adhesion of fiber webs onto a drying surface, and the creping of the fiber webs to obtain a soft, bulky tissue paper web.
